B. Allow the readings to settle, then get the Series 2600B readings:
r0_hi, r0_lo = smua.contact.r()
C. Characterize both 50 resistors using the resistance function of the digital multimeter.
D. As illustrated in the following figure:
Characterize both 50 Ω resistors using the resistance function of the digital multimeter.
Connect a 50 Ω resistor between the SENSE LO and LO terminals.
Connect the second 50 Ω resistor between the SENSE HI and HI terminals.
Figure 152: Connections for contact check 50 ohm calibration
E. Allow the readings to settle, then get the Series 2600B readings:
r50_hi, r50_lo = smua.contact.r()
F. Send the contact check low calibration adjustment command:
smua.contact.calibratelo(r0_lo, Z_actual, r50_lo, 50_ohm_actual)
Where:
r0_lo
=
Series 2600B 0 low measurement
Z_actual
= Actual zero value; the resistance of the short between the SENSE LO and LO
terminals
r50_lo
=
Series 2600B 50 low measurement
50_ohm_actual
=
Actual 50 resistor value; the actual value of the resistor between the SENSE
LO and LO terminals
Typical values:
smua.contact.calibratelo(r0_lo, 0, r50_lo, 50.15)
Where r0_lo is the same value as measured in step B, and r50_lo is the same value as
measured in step E.
